Transaction 37f85a03501bb48e7c61894332a7646b3161a0b5a5f11d55b51f814c9798569c

86 Input
2 Outputs
  • 37f85a03501bb48e7c61894332a7646b3161a0b5a5f11d55b51f814c9798569c:0
  • value  921038
    address  338jnAa4dEo8pSYNQvotEGt2UU5jCV8BCE
  • 37f85a03501bb48e7c61894332a7646b3161a0b5a5f11d55b51f814c9798569c:1
  • value  2045648330
    address  3BFHgy9ppwufRmoLVyeQmU4TkpFJEGgyzf